
こんにちは。どちらも Linux ベースのシステムであり、どちらも Linux カーネルで実行されているのに、Xubuntu が正常に動作するために必要な RAM が Ubuntu よりも少ないのはなぜか知りたいです。組み込みタスクの一部が実行されていないため、RAM がシステムによっていっぱいにならないためでしょうか。
私は両方を異なるタイプのハードウェアでテストしましたが、Xubuntuははるかに弱いハードウェアでも実行できました。
答え1
これは Linux カーネルを実行することではありません。カーネル自体は RAM をあまり消費しません。カーネルが提供する使いやすさ、機能、外観、およびカーネルに含まれるデフォルトのアプリケーションの要件に関するものです。
Ubuntu はデスクトップのレンダリングに compiz を使用します。Compiz は、Xubuntu が使用する xfwm4 よりもグラフィックが豊かです。Compiz は、xfwm4 が苦手とするスナップやホットコーナーの感度など、非常に便利なジェスチャ サポートを提供します。
繰り返しになりますが、Xubuntu のデフォルト アプリケーションはすべて、リソースの消費を抑えるために見た目と機能を省いています。たとえば、Xubuntu のシステム モニターでは、CPU、メモリ、およびネットワークの使用状況のリアルタイム グラフは表示されません。
もう一つの例は、Ubuntuの検索機能です。ダッシュで「」という語句を検索すると、テキスト編集、すべてのテキストエディタが表示されます。これには、文章または編集名前に Libreoffice-Writer が含まれていました。結果には Sublime Text、GVim、Medit、Atom のほか、Libreoffice-Writer も見つかりました。Xubuntu にはアプリケーション ファインダーが備わっていますが、検索しても結果に Libreoffice-Writer は表示されませんでした。
Ubuntu は、アクティビティ ロガーとして機能する Zeitgeist を使用し、ユーザーの使用パターンに基づいて、アプリケーションとアイテムを関連付けて、将来的にすばやく見つけられるようにします。Xubuntu にはこのような機能は含まれていません。
もう 1 つの例としては、含まれているテキスト エディターが挙げられます。Gedit は、マウスパッドよりも機能が豊富なエディターです。Gedit はプラグインを使用して拡張できますが、マウスパッドはこのように拡張できません。
同じ理論は、Xubuntu に含まれる他のすべてのアプリケーションにも当てはまります。両方を使用している人なら、当然のことながらそれがわかるでしょう。
両方を使用したユーザーがこの質問をするのは、かなり驚きです。NFS2 が NFS Underground よりも少ない RAM を必要とする理由を尋ねるようなものです。
Compizの機能を紹介する多数のビデオをご覧ください。
YouTube でたくさん見つかります。見れば、Xubuntu と同じ量の RAM (および CPU) 要件を期待すべきではないと認めるでしょう。
読書
- 翻訳元Wikipedia記事
- コンピズWikipedia記事
- Compiz プロジェクト ページ
答え2
Xubuntu は 2 次元デスクトップを使用しますが、Ubuntu は 3 次元デスクトップを提供します。ご想像のとおり、デスクトップを 3 次元で表現すると、より多くの RAM が必要になり、プログラミングが複雑になります。複雑になるとプログラムが大きくなり、より多くの RAM が消費されます。
具体的には、Xubuntu は xfce デスクトップを使用するのに対し、Ubuntu は gnome デスクトップを使用します。Xubuntu ファイル マネージャー (ファイル ブラウザー) は Thunar と呼ばれます。Ubuntu ファイル マネージャーは nautilus です。
より詳細な比較については以下をご覧ください:簡単Linuxヒントプロジェクト/xubuntu